Liquid Liner 101




Have you ever wondered how some make-up artists are able to do a perfect wing-tip with liquid liner?
Well here is a step by step way of achieving those "Angelina Jolie" cat eyes. You will need liquid liner and 2 small pieces of regular tape. The kind we use to wrap our gifts during the holidays. It's light weight and won't pull the skin.

1) Apply two small pieces of tape on the outer corner of each eye in a slanted position facing outward.

2) Start applying liquid liner from the inner corner of your eye the with the side of your brush as close as possible to your lash line.

3) Drag it across your lash line and lift your hand just a tad as you approach your outer eye to the or    over the tape in order to create a thicker line. In other words you will be now drawing a line on your eyelid as opposed to keeping close to the lash line.

4) Sometimes a space is created when you transition the line from the lash line to the eyelid. Fill in that empty space with liner sparingly.

Don't forget a few coats of mascara to finish the look!
